occasion
Pronunciation:
/əˈkeɪʒən/noun
Definitions
A favorable opportunity; a convenient or timely chance.
Example: At this point, she seized the occasion to make her own observation.
The time when something happens.
Example: on this occasion, I'm going to decline your offer, but next time I might agree.
An occurrence or state of affairs which causes some event or reaction; a motive or reason.
Example: I had no occasion to feel offended, however.
Something which causes something else; a cause.
verb
Definitions
To cause; to produce; to induce
Example: it is seen that the mental changes are occasioned by a change of polarity
